Archie Andrews and Geoffrey Giraffe are teaming up to launch the brand new LIFE WITH ARCHIE magazine debuting this August! Until recently, Toys Я Us carried a limited selection of magazines and comics. Now, through the combined marketing efforts of Kable News and Select Media Services, Archie Comic Publications, Inc. will have a huge presence in ALL 585 US  Toys Я Us stores!

 "The partnership with Toys Я Us is a perfect fit. We both focus on providing high quality entertainment to children of all ages,” remarked Archie Comics Publisher, Jon Goldwater. “There is no better combination anywhere than America's Favorite Teenager and the World's Greatest Toy Store!"

 The ARCHIE comic book and both Sonic titles, SONIC THE HEDGEHOG and SONIC UNIVERSE, will be in a special rack to be located in the Collectors section of every Toys Я Us store. The brand new magazine LIFE WITH ARCHIE will be featured at the checkout, also in all Toys Я Us stores.

 The already wildly popular LIFE WITH ARCHIE magazine presents the married life of Archie Andrews to both the rich and vivacious brunette, Veronica, and the beautiful blond girl-next-door, Betty. The two new series spring out of the acclaimed "The Archie Wedding: Archie in Will You Marry Me?" storyline. Both stories are available exclusively in the LIFE WITH ARCHIE magazine along with extra star-studded bonus features!

 “This is great additional newsstand exposure for the comics and a great platform for the launch of the LIFE WITH ARCHIE magazine. We are thrilled to have Toys Я Us join our other retail partners,” said Archie Comics Director of Circulation, Bill Horan.

 Archie Comics’ magazines and comic books will be available in all US Toys Я Us stores beginning August 2010
